The Site Assessment and Remediation practice at AKRF delivers value on projects of all scopes and sizes, from individual lots and single-use buildings to large-scale mixed-use developments, corporate and institutional campuses, renewable energy facilities, and infrastructure improvements. We seek an entry environmental scientist/geologist/engineer to support our growing Site Assessment and Remediation practice in delivering healthier, safer, and more sustainable sites to our clients. This position could be based in our New York City or White Plains Offices. The position entails field-related assignments in the NYC-metro area, which requires local travel. Non-field assignments will be conducted in hybrid.
Job Responsibilities:
• Phase I Environmental Site Assessments.
• Phase II/Subsurface/Remedial Investigations including logging borings and soil, groundwater, soil vapor, and indoor air sampling.
• Remediation oversight and community air monitoring related to brownfield redevelopment.
• Oversight of subcontractors such as drillers, excavation companies, and remedial contractors.
• Data interpretation, report preparation and writing (Work Plans, Phase II and Remedial Investigation Reports, Remedial Plans, etc.).
